Press-fit cementless acetabular fixation with and without screws
Sheng-Hui Ni1, Lei Guo, Tian-Long Jiang
1Department of Orthopedic Surgery, First Affiliated Hospital, China Medical University, Shenyang, Liaoning, 110001, People's Republic of China.
International Orthopaedics
|August 29, 2013
Summary
Screws do not significantly improve cementless acetabular fixation in total hip arthroplasty (THA). This meta-analysis found no difference in revisions, migration, or osteolysis between acetabular cups with and without screws.

Background:
- Cementless acetabular fixation is a standard technique in total hip arthroplasty (THA).
- The role of supplementary screws in enhancing acetabular cup fixation remains a topic of clinical discussion.
Purpose of the Study:
- To conduct a meta-analysis comparing cementless acetabular cup fixation with and without screws in THA.
- To evaluate the impact of screw use on primary and secondary fixation.
Main Methods:
- Systematic literature search of Embase, PubMed, and Cochrane Library up to May 2013.
- Inclusion of five randomized controlled trials involving 1,130 total hip arthroplasties.
- Meta-analysis using RevMan 5.0, assessing revisions, migration, and osteolysis.
Main Results:
- Pooled data from five trials (1,130 THAs) showed no statistically significant differences.
- No significant variations were observed in revision rates, cup migration, or osteolysis between fixation methods.
Conclusions:
- Cementless acetabular fixation in THA with or without screws yields comparable outcomes.
- Screws do not demonstrate a significant benefit regarding revisions, migration, or osteolysis in this meta-analysis.
